The Afghani president, who arrived in Islamabad on a two-day visit, visited Pakistan's Army Headquarters in Rawalpindi and met Army Chief General Raheel Sharif, the military said.


President Ghnai appreciated Pakistan's efforts to fight terrorism and sacrifices rendered by the nation and also assured of Afghan cooperation to jointly curb the menace of terrorism, an army statement said.


The Afghani delegation was given detailed briefing on security situation on the Pak-Afghan border.


General Raheel Sharif received the Afghan President at the General Headquarters.


A smartly turned out contingent of Pakistan Army presented him guard of honor. Afghan President Ashraf Ghani laid floral wreath at the "Shuhada (martyrs) Monument and offered prayers.


President Ghani received several Pakistani ministers and political leaders and discussed bilateral matters, focusing on security and economic relations. He also met Pakistani businessmen and invited them to invest in Afghanistan.


The Afghan president will hold talks with his Pakistani counterpart Mamnoon Hussain late Friday, who will also host a banquet in his honor.


Ashraf Ghani will hold talks with Pakistani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if on Saturday and the two will watch together a cricket match between the A teams of the two countries.




BUENOS AIRES, Nov. 18 (Xinhua) -- Lionel Messi paid the wages of Argentine team's security staff out of his own pocket after hearing they hadn't received their salary for six months, according to media reports.


The Argentine Football Association is mirred in an going financial crisis amid allegations of corruption and mismanagement.


Journalist Juan Pablo Varsky told Metro 95 radio that Messi was told of his countrymen's plight before Argentina's World Cup qualifier against Brazil in Belo Horizonte last week.


"Messi was in his room... when a knock at the door came," Varsky said. "Two or three people appeared, all from the security team who look after the Argentine squad. They said, 'Leo, we have to talk with you. For five or six months they have not paid us. The situation is complicated, you are the captain of the team, you know us, we are asking for your help'."


According to Varsky, Messi immediately called his father, Jorge, asking that he sent the money to the unpaid staff.


"When Messi finds out that someone told this he will be furious, but it doesn't matter," said Varsky. "There are a lot of actions he doesn't want people to know about but I thought it pertinent to tell this because there is no reason not to, save for his anger."


BEIJING, May 26 (Xinhua) -- When Chinese technology firm DJI was founded in 2006, the idea of civilian drones was far beyond the grasp of ordinary consumers.


In less than 10 years, the Shenzhen-based company is now a leading manufacturer of commercial and recreational drones for aerial photography and videography. Its products currently account for almost 70 percent of the market share worldwide, with Europe and North America its biggest customers.


"We can proudly say DJI opened up the civilian-drone market," said Shao Jianhuo, director of the company's public relations department.


DJI is one of the many emerging Chinese companies refuting the long-existing image - cheap and low-quality- of Chinese products.


"We hope we will change the established international perceptions of Chinese products," Shao said.


In the past, Chinese companies managed to eke out a living by taking advantage of low labor costs and cheap resources to engage in low-end manufacturing of products such as garments, toys, and shoes. Scarcely have companies earned a global reputation for premium quality or taste.


Sometimes referred to as the "world's factory", nearly 90 percent of China's manufactured and exported goods are not indigenous brands. The country is still far from becoming a true manufacturing powerhouse.


Take the domestic market as an example, notable high-end products from cars to cosmetics have for long been dominated by brands from developed markets.


With the government's efforts to accelerate industrial upgrades, restructure the economic growth pattern and encourage innovation in the new century, things are gradually beginning to change.


Comfortable and safe trains made by China CNR currently provide 80 percent of rail transport services in Rio de Janeiro, host city of the 2016 Summer Olympics.


Li Tiezheng, a Chinese mechanic dispatched by the CNR to serve the city's subway operation during the FIFA World Cup last year, recalled being praised by European passengers after they discovered the trains had come from China.


"It's really cool being a Chinese at that moment," Li said.


A subway company in the Brazilian megacity has ordered 604 subway and commuter trains from Chinese manufacturers. Some 90 trains which the Chinese manufacturers will deliver soon may be used for the Olympics.


During his visit to Brazil last week, Chinese Premier Li Keqiang took a ride on a subway train in Rio, which "has mature technologies and runs stably," as described by the train driver.


Li told Brazilian officials that China has superior technologies and powerful equipment manufacturing capacity in railroad transport, and China-made products are cost-effective and adaptable to various markets.


In recent years, Chinese Internet companies such as Alibaba, Baidu and Tencent have also gained global stardom.
